The artwork was created using acrylic on canvas, with the dimensions of 30x40 cm.
Born in Catania in 1962, Giovanna Mancuso graduated in the Istituto d'Arte of Catania, collaborating with Nino Mustica. In 1986 she continued her studies at the DAMS of Bologna and in 1988 participated in the "Biennale Giovani Bologna" and since then she actively proposes her works in exhibitions all over the country, but also abroad, exposing at "Japanese Garden" in Catania, " MarteLive Biennale "in Rome,"International Mail Art projects" between Brazil, Italy, Spain and Portugal, and "Verba Volant, Art Manent", as well as "Art Takes Times Square "and "Creative Rising Exhibition" in New York.
Continuing the search for different forms of expression, the artist comes to the study of Zen and oriental Shodo calligraphy. The oriental calligraphy, intimately linked to the painting, is a real Art and a practice of life that needs constant exercise and prevents blemishes.
Here the sign is swelling, black lines, soft, sharp, energetic, becoming visual poetry, in an order of composition from which ratios of solids and voids emerge. One perceives a rhythm, a flow of gestures, a variability of force. A free private alphabet of meaning that stands on the canvas and support a transitional musicality that becomes lyricism.
